I bet you're looking at the accompanying photo and thinking: "Oh, Recessionista. Why are you teasing us with an image of a beautiful Prada handbag? We are girls on a budget."
Yes, yes we are. But that doesn't mean we can't have the finer things in life from time to time, no? And when you're renting - yes, renting - this little metallic gold goddess (which retails for $1,500, but can be temporarily yours for $40) then there is nothing to fuss over.
Jennifer Hudson's character showed us the light in last year's "Sex In The City" movie when she bedazzled Carrie (Sarah Jessica Parker) with her rented Louis Vuitton. Recessionistas across the country buzzed about Bag Borrow Or Steal, the company that started the designer handbag rental craze. (It is now called Avelle, but the Web site name remains www.bagborroworsteal.com.)
And bags straight off the runway aren't the only thing up for grabs. The latest Tiffany choker, the must-have Chanel shades and watches for the menfolk are all there for the taking, er ... borrowing.
The process is super-convenient, easy and relatively affordable. Visit www.bagborroworsteal.com, set up an account, pick a bag and try not to scare the heck out of the UPS guy when he delivers it (like I did).
Hey, it's Prada. He should have known.
